MTBE深度脱硫技术的应用

         

摘要

In order to meet the sulfur standard of Beijing V for MTBE product, we explored deep desulfurization for the production of MTBE. The basic data of thermodynamics of MTBE desulfurization are used in this thesis to simulation the process. Using the method of chemical process simulation and analysis, the process of MTBE desulfurization was studied. By comprehensive analysis of process technology conditions, the advantages and disadvantages of single column process technology and double columns process technology were analyzed, and the feasible technology solutions of MTBE deep desulfurization under different conditions was proposed. The suitable technology has been applied in the renovation of MTBE unit. The sulfur standard of MTBE is lower than 3 mg/kg.%  为生产满足京Ⅴ汽油含硫标准的甲基叔丁基醚(MTBE)产品,探讨了MTBE深度脱硫原理,利用MTBE脱硫体系的热力学基础数据,采用化工流程模拟与分析的方法,对MTBE脱硫过程进行了全面系统的模拟研究。通过对工艺条件的综合分析,明确了单塔、双塔两种脱硫工艺的利弊,提出了适于不同工况的可行的 MTBE 深度脱硫技术方案。在MTBE装置改造中取得了良好的应用效果,MTBE产品的硫含量不高于3 mg/kg。
